SC Transfers Petitions on CCI Probe Against Amazon-Flipkart to Karnataka HC

  • Case Name: Competition Commission of India v. Cloudtail India Private Limited
  • Judge(s): Justice Abhay Oka, Justice Ujjal Bhuyan
  • Advocate(s): Mr. R. Venkataramani, Dr. Abhishek Manu

The Supreme Court transferred 26 writ petitions challenging the Competition Commission of India’s (CCI) investigation into Amazon and Flipkart-associated sellers to the Karnataka High Court.

The CCI initiated the probe in January 2020 under Section 26(1) of the Competition Act, 2002, based on allegations of anti-competitive practices and preferential treatment of select sellers.

The Court emphasized uniformity and timely resolution, directing all future related petitions to the Karnataka High Court single-judge bench, where similar matters are already under consideration.

This move consolidates proceedings to prevent delays, ensuring adherence to procedural efficiency in competition law adjudication.
